Obituaries 5-4-2016: Ralph Dolan

News Progress Posted on May 4, 2016 by webmasterMay 4, 2016

Dolan, Ralph 001Ralph Dolan

Ralph Ames Dolan, 81, of Sullivan, passed away at 3:22 a.m. Saturday, April 30, 2016 in Aspen Creek in Sullivan.

Funeral services were held at 2 p.m. Tuesday, May 3 in McMullin-Young Funeral Home in Sullivan. Burial was in French Cemetery in Allenville.         Ralph was born November 19, 1934 in Mattoon, a son of Carl Layton and Myrtle Ames Dolan. He graduated from Sullivan High School with the class of 1953, served in the Army and was a graduate of Eureka College. He served as the payroll master at the Palmer House in Chicago and also worked at Blaw-Knox in Mattoon as a security guard. In his retirement he worked at the Mattoon Walmart as a welcome greeter. Ralph was a lifetime member of First Christian Church of Sullivan. He was an avid reader and a dedicated sports fan who loved the St. Louis Cardinals; Ralph loved fishing, hunting and all of his animals he cared for on the farm. Read More

Obituaries 4-27-2016: Roger Gustin

News Progress Posted on April 27, 2016 by webmasterApril 27, 2016

GustinRogerRoger Gustin

Roger Orval Gustin, passed away peacefully February 28, 2016 at the age of 81 ending his long battle with Parkinson’s Disease. He was surrounded by his immediate family.

Roger was born June 20, 1934 in Sullivan, graduating with the high school class of 1952 where he was a member of the H.S. band and lettered in basketball, baseball, football and track. Roger received his bachelor degree from Millikin University in Decatur and then his master’s degree in administration and teaching credential from Eastern Illinois University in Charleston. In 1960 Roger moved to Madera, California and started teaching at Madera High School from where he retired in 1992. In 1963 Roger married Joan Cappelluti of Madera, and they were together for 47 years. She predeceased him in 2010.  Read More
